Novice photographers consider pictures for personal use, as a hobby or outside of relaxed fascination, in lieu of as a company or task. The caliber of novice function may be comparable to that of numerous specialists. Amateurs can fill a niche in subjects or topics Which may not if not be photographed if they don't seem to be commercially handy or salable. Newbie photography grew in the late nineteenth century due to the popularization of the hand-held digicam.
